Peace - Japanese Tracklist

Post by RiseInGlory »

Both the French Libera-Dream forum and the Chinese fan forum on Baidu are reporting this

http://www.hmv.co.jp/en/product/detail/3744332" onclick="window.open(this.href);return false;

Some of the titles are in Japanese so I'm going to take a stab at translating them

1. Ave Virgo (?) - Japanese title appears to be misspelled
2. Faithful Heart
3. Lacrymosa
4. Time
5. Adoro
6. O Sanctissima
7. Deep Peace
8. How Shall I Sing
9. Lead, Kindly Light
10. Exsultate
11. Panis Angelicus
12. Lullaby
13. Trees
Bonus Tracks:
14. Mother of God
15. How Can I Keep From Singing
16. Heaven
17. Far Away
